The Province of Rizal is a land of vast resources, abundant water supply, untapped mineral resources, with access to markets and trade advantages, numerous tourism potentials, favorable peace and order climate, various investable and bankable industries, and skilled labor force.

 

Rizal has an estimated population of 1.7 million people as of Year 2000, with an annual growth rate of 5.8 percent. The predominant language is Filipino while the English language is used as the medium of communication in business and education. The literacy rate of household population ten years old and over is a high 98.5 percent. The province is composed of thirteen municipalities and one component city divided into three political districts and further subdivided into 187 barangays. Its total land area is about 130,383 hectares

 

All 13 municipalities and its lone city form part of the Laguna de Bay Region.
